What does the word "Headfirst" mean?

The term "headfirst" is an adverb that describes a particular manner of moving or proceeding, typically with the head or upper body leading the way. While it can apply to various contexts, its core meaning centers on a sense of urgency or recklessness. Let's delve into the different interpretations and usages of this intriguing word.

In its most literal sense, "headfirst" refers to a physical action where someone dives or plunges into something with their head leading. This can be seen in various activities, such as swimming, gymnastics, or even jumping into a pool. However, the concept expands beyond mere physical action and extends into metaphorical use as well.

The origin of the term can be traced back to the combination of "head," referring to the front part of the body, and "first," indicating priority or precedence. Together, they create a vivid image of moving forward with one's head leading, symbolizing courage, impulsiveness, or merely a direct approach to life’s challenges.
